Is there a way to auto-generate a weekly changelog page from a graph? As in: Changelog 6/21/22 - 6/26/22 —————————————- New pages ————— - [[Yam]] - [[Uzu]] - [[Peach]] Updated Pages ——————— - [[Apples]] - [[Cherries]] With some template editing of static fields

Trying to think of a way to generate an automated chronological update stream from an evolving roam graph to feed an email newsletter or blog Also open to ways of doing this directly from a git repo of markdown files that generates a static site

One challenging part here with markdown generated sites is that if you change a page title (within Obsidian) it’ll change all of the links on other pages so the link doesn’t break. This makes the change log look much bigger than it is for a simple rename.
